引言:教育创新的时代机遇

在数字化浪潮席卷全球的今天,教育行业正经历着前所未有的变革。环球优学教育作为行业领先的教育科技公司,始终致力于通过技术创新推动教育公平与质量提升。我们相信,教育的未来在于融合前沿科技与人文关怀,而这一切都需要最优秀的人才共同实现。本文将详细介绍环球优学教育的创新理念、团队文化、招聘岗位及发展路径,帮助您全面了解如何加入我们,共同塑造教育的未来。

一、环球优学教育的创新理念与使命

1.1 教育科技的前沿探索

环球优学教育成立于2015年,总部位于北京,是一家专注于K12及成人教育的科技驱动型教育企业。我们的核心使命是“让优质教育触手可及”,通过人工智能、大数据和云计算等技术,打破地域限制,为全球学习者提供个性化、高效的学习体验。

技术驱动的教育创新案例

  • AI自适应学习系统:我们开发了基于机器学习算法的智能推荐引擎,能够根据学生的学习行为、知识掌握程度和认知风格,动态调整学习路径。例如,系统会分析学生在数学练习中的错误类型,自动推送针对性的巩固练习和讲解视频。
  • 虚拟现实(VR)课堂:针对科学实验等难以实体操作的课程,我们引入了VR技术。学生可以通过VR设备“进入”虚拟实验室,安全地进行化学实验或物理模拟,大大提升了学习的趣味性和效果。

1.2 数据驱动的教育决策

环球优学教育拥有庞大的教育数据资产,通过数据分析优化教学内容和教学方法。我们的数据团队利用Python和R等工具,构建了复杂的预测模型,帮助教师识别学习困难的学生,并提前进行干预。

数据科学在教育中的应用示例

# 示例:使用Python构建学生成绩预测模型
import pandas as pd
from sklearn.ensemble import RandomForestRegressor
from sklearn.model_selection import train_test_split

# 加载学生历史数据(假设数据包含学习时间、作业完成率、测验成绩等特征)
data = pd.read_csv('student_performance.csv')

# 特征选择与数据预处理
features = ['study_hours', 'assignment_completion_rate', 'quiz_scores', 'attendance']
X = data[features]
y = data['final_exam_score']

#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)

# 训练随机森林回归模型
model = RandomForestRegressor(n_estimators=100, random_state=42)
model.fit(X_train, y_train)

# 评估模型
score = model.score(X_test, y_test)
print(f"模型预测准确率: {score:.2f}")

# 使用模型预测新学生的成绩
new_student = pd.DataFrame([[10, 0.9, 85, 0.95]], columns=features)
predicted_score = model.predict(new_student)
print(f"预测新学生期末成绩: {predicted_score[0]:.1f}")

通过这样的模型,教师可以提前发现可能不及格的学生,并提供额外的辅导资源,从而提高整体通过率。

二、团队文化与价值观

2.1 创新与协作

环球优学教育的团队文化强调“创新无界,协作共赢”。我们鼓励员工提出新想法,并提供资源支持实验。每周的“创新工作坊”是团队分享创意、碰撞思想的平台。例如,我们的“智能作文批改”功能最初就是由一位语文教师和一位工程师在工作坊中共同提出的。

2.2 持续学习与成长

我们相信,教育者自身也需要不断学习。公司提供每年至少200小时的培训预算,涵盖技术、教学法和领导力等多个领域。员工可以参加在线课程、行业会议或攻读学位,公司会给予部分补贴。

员工成长案例

  • 张工程师:加入公司时是一名初级前端开发,通过参与多个AI教育项目,掌握了机器学习知识,现在已成为AI产品团队的技术负责人。
  • 李老师:一位传统教师,通过公司的教学法培训,学会了使用数据工具分析学生表现,现在负责设计个性化学习方案,学生成绩提升显著。

2.3 多元与包容

我们重视团队的多样性,认为不同的背景和视角能激发更多创新。团队成员来自全球20多个国家,涵盖教育、技术、设计、心理学等不同专业。我们定期举办文化分享活动,促进相互理解。

三、招聘岗位详解

3.1 技术类岗位

3.1.1 人工智能工程师

岗位职责

  • 开发和优化教育领域的AI算法,如自然语言处理(NLP)用于作文批改、计算机视觉用于学习行为分析。
  • 与产品经理和教师合作,将教育需求转化为技术解决方案。
  • 维护和扩展公司的AI平台,确保高可用性和可扩展性。

技能要求

  • 熟练掌握Python、TensorFlow/PyTorch等深度学习框架。
  • 有NLP或计算机视觉项目经验,熟悉教育数据者优先。
  • 良好的沟通能力,能将技术概念解释给非技术人员。

示例项目: 开发一个智能作文批改系统,使用BERT模型进行语法错误检测和内容评价。代码示例:

# 使用Hugging Face的Transformers库进行作文批改
from transformers import pipeline

# 初始化情感分析和语法检查管道
grammar_checker = pipeline("text-classification", model="textattack/roberta-base-CoLA")
sentiment_analyzer = pipeline("sentiment-analysis")

def grade_essay(text):
    # 语法检查
    grammar_result = grammar_checker(text)
    grammar_score = 1.0 if grammar_result[0]['label'] == 'LABEL_1' else 0.5
    
    # 情感分析(用于评估文章情感表达)
    sentiment_result = sentiment_analyzer(text)
    sentiment_score = 0.5 if sentiment_result[0]['label'] == 'NEGATIVE' else 1.0
    
    # 综合评分(简化示例)
    total_score = (grammar_score + sentiment_score) / 2 * 100
    feedback = f"语法得分: {grammar_score*100:.0f}, 情感表达: {sentiment_score*100:.0f}, 综合评分: {total_score:.1f}"
    
    return feedback

# 测试
essay = "I am very happy to learn English. It is interesting and useful."
print(grade_essay(essay))

3.1.2 全栈开发工程师

岗位职责

  • 负责教育平台的前后端开发,包括用户界面、API接口和数据库设计。
  • 优化系统性能,确保百万级用户的并发访问。
  • 参与代码审查和架构设计。

技能要求

  • 熟练掌握JavaScript/TypeScript、React/Vue、Node.js/Python等。
  • 熟悉数据库(如MySQL、MongoDB)和云服务(如AWS、阿里云)。
  • 有大型Web应用开发经验者优先。

示例项目: 构建一个实时互动课堂系统,支持视频流、聊天和白板功能。使用WebSocket实现实时通信:

// 前端使用React和WebSocket
import React, { useState, useEffect } from 'react';

function Classroom() {
    const [messages, setMessages] = useState([]);
    const [input, setInput] = useState('');
    const ws = new WebSocket('wss://classroom.example.com/ws');

    useEffect(() => {
        ws.onmessage = (event) => {
            const message = JSON.parse(event.data);
            setMessages(prev => [...prev, message]);
        };

        return () => ws.close();
    }, []);

    const sendMessage = () => {
        if (input.trim()) {
            ws.send(JSON.stringify({ type: 'chat', content: input }));
            setInput('');
        }
    };

    return (
        <div>
            <div id="whiteboard">白板区域</div>
            <div id="chat">
                {messages.map((msg, idx) => (
                    <p key={idx}>{msg.user}: {msg.content}</p>
                ))}
            </div>
            <input 
                value={input} 
                onChange={e => setInput(e.target.value)} 
                onKeyPress={e => e.key === 'Enter' && sendMessage()}
            />
            <button onClick={sendMessage}>发送</button>
        </div>
    );
}

3.2 教育类岗位

3.2.1 课程设计师

岗位职责

  • 设计符合新课标和学生认知规律的课程体系。
  • 开发多媒体教学资源,包括视频、互动课件和练习题。
  • 与技术团队合作,将课程内容集成到学习平台中。

技能要求

  • 本科及以上学历,教育学、心理学或相关专业。
  • 3年以上K12或成人教育课程设计经验。
  • 熟悉教育技术工具,如Articulate Storyline、Adobe Captivate。

示例项目: 设计一个“Python编程入门”课程,包含以下模块:

  1. 基础语法:通过互动动画讲解变量、循环等概念。
  2. 项目实践:学生使用在线代码编辑器完成小项目,如计算器开发。
  3. 评估系统:自动评分和反馈,使用代码执行引擎测试学生代码。

课程设计文档示例(Markdown格式):

# Python编程入门课程大纲

## 模块1:变量与数据类型
- **学习目标**:理解变量概念,掌握整数、字符串等数据类型。
- **教学内容**:
  - 视频:变量赋值动画演示(5分钟)
  - 互动练习:拖拽匹配数据类型与示例
  - 代码挑战:编写代码计算两个数的和
- **评估**:自动测试代码正确性,提供即时反馈。

## 模块2:控制流
- **学习目标**:掌握if-else语句和循环结构。
- **教学内容**:
  - 视频:流程图讲解控制流(8分钟)
  - 互动模拟:通过调整条件观察程序行为变化
  - 项目:开发一个简单的猜数字游戏
- **评估**:项目评分基于代码质量、功能完整性和注释。

3.2.2 学习体验设计师

岗位职责

  • 优化用户学习旅程,提升参与度和完成率。
  • 进行用户研究,收集反馈并迭代产品。
  • 设计激励系统,如徽章、排行榜等。

技能要求

  • 有用户体验(UX)设计经验,熟悉Figma、Sketch等工具。
  • 了解游戏化学习理论。
  • 数据分析能力,能使用Google Analytics或类似工具。

示例项目: 设计一个游戏化学习系统,学生通过完成任务获得积分和徽章。系统架构:

# 后端:积分和徽章系统
class GamificationSystem:
    def __init__(self):
        self.points = {}
        self.badges = {}
    
    def award_points(self, user_id, activity_type, points):
        if user_id not in self.points:
            self.points[user_id] = 0
        self.points[user_id] += points
        # 检查是否获得徽章
        self.check_badges(user_id)
    
    def check_badges(self, user_id):
        score = self.points.get(user_id, 0)
        if score >= 100 and 'Beginner' not in self.badges.get(user_id, []):
            self.badges.setdefault(user_id, []).append('Beginner')
        if score >= 500 and 'Intermediate' not in self.badges.get(user_id, []):
            self.badges.setdefault(user_id, []).append('Intermediate')
    
    def get_user_status(self, user_id):
        return {
            'points': self.points.get(user_id, 0),
            'badges': self.badges.get(user_id, [])
        }

# 使用示例
system = GamificationSystem()
system.award_points('user123', 'quiz', 50)
system.award_points('user123', 'project', 100)
print(system.get_user_status('user123'))
# 输出: {'points': 150, 'badges': ['Beginner']}

3.3 运营与市场类岗位

3.3.1 教育产品经理

岗位职责

  • 定义产品路线图,协调技术、设计和教育团队。
  • 分析市场趋势和用户数据,制定产品策略。
  • 管理产品生命周期,从概念到发布。

技能要求

  • 3年以上教育或科技产品管理经验。
  • 熟悉敏捷开发流程。
  • 强大的数据分析和沟通能力。

示例项目: 负责“智能学习助手”产品,整合AI答疑、学习计划和进度跟踪。产品需求文档(PRD)示例:

# 智能学习助手PRD

## 1. 产品概述
- **目标**:帮助学生自主规划学习,提高效率。
- **核心功能**:
  - AI答疑:基于NLP的实时问答。
  - 学习计划:根据目标自动生成每日任务。
  - 进度跟踪:可视化学习数据。

## 2. 用户场景
- **场景1**:学生遇到数学难题,使用AI答疑获取步骤解析。
- **场景2**:学生设定“期末考试复习”目标,系统生成复习计划。

## 3. 技术需求
- 后端:Python Flask API,集成NLP模型。
- 前端:React Native移动应用。
- 数据:使用MongoDB存储用户数据。

## 4. 成功指标
- 用户日活(DAU)增长20%。
- 平均学习时长提升15%。
- 用户满意度评分4.5/5以上。

3.3.2 社区运营经理

岗位职责

  • 建立和维护学习者社区,促进用户互动。
  • 策划线上活动,如学习挑战赛、专家讲座。
  • 监测用户反馈,推动产品改进。

技能要求

  • 有社区运营或社交媒体管理经验。
  • 优秀的文案和活动策划能力。
  • 熟悉教育行业,了解学习者需求。

示例项目: 策划“30天编程挑战”活动,吸引用户参与并提升平台活跃度。活动方案:

# 30天编程挑战活动方案

## 活动目标
- 提升用户参与度,增加日活。
- 推广Python课程,吸引新用户。

## 活动设计
- **每日任务**:通过邮件和App推送每日编程任务(如“第1天:打印Hello World”)。
- **社区互动**:在论坛分享代码,互相评论。
- **奖励机制**:完成挑战获得证书和课程优惠券。

## 技术实现
- 使用自动化邮件系统(如SendGrid)发送每日任务。
- 在App内集成任务打卡功能。
- 数据追踪:监控参与率和完成率。

## 预期效果
- 参与用户数:5000人。
- 完成率:30%。
- 新用户转化率:10%。

四、加入我们:职业发展路径

4.1 入职培训与导师制

新员工入职后,将接受为期两周的集中培训,涵盖公司文化、产品知识和工作流程。每位新员工都会分配一位资深导师,提供一对一指导,帮助快速融入团队。

4.2 多通道晋升体系

我们提供技术、管理和专业三条晋升通道,员工可根据兴趣和能力选择发展方向:

  • 技术通道:初级工程师 → 中级工程师 → 高级工程师 → 技术专家 → 首席架构师。
  • 管理通道:团队负责人 → 部门经理 → 总监 → 副总裁。
  • 专业通道:初级设计师 → 资深设计师 → 设计专家 → 设计总监。

晋升案例

  • 王工程师:入职3年,从初级工程师晋升为技术专家,主导了AI批改系统的开发,获得公司创新奖。
  • 陈老师:入职5年,从课程设计师晋升为教育产品总监,负责多个产品线的战略规划。

4.3 薪酬福利

  • 有竞争力的薪酬:基础工资 + 绩效奖金 + 股权激励。
  • 全面福利:五险一金、补充医疗保险、年度体检、带薪年假。
  • 学习基金:每年5000元学习预算,用于课程、书籍或会议。
  • 灵活工作:支持远程办公和弹性工作时间。

五、如何申请

5.1 申请流程

  1. 在线申请:访问环球优学教育官网(www.globalstudy.com/careers),填写申请表并上传简历。
  2. 初筛:HR团队将在3个工作日内审核简历。
  3. 面试:包括技术/专业面试、团队面试和文化匹配面试。
  4. 录用通知:面试通过后,发放录用通知并协商入职时间。

5.2 准备建议

  • 技术岗位:准备项目作品集,熟悉常见算法和系统设计问题。
  • 教育岗位:准备课程设计案例或教学成果数据。
  • 运营岗位:准备活动策划案或社区运营案例。

5.3 联系方式

  • 招聘邮箱:careers@globalstudy.com
  • 电话:+86-10-12345678
  • 社交媒体:关注微信公众号“环球优学招聘”获取最新职位。

六、结语:共创教育未来

环球优学教育不仅仅是一家公司,更是一个致力于改变教育的社区。我们相信,每一位加入的英才都能在这里找到属于自己的舞台,通过技术创新和教育智慧,为全球学习者创造更美好的未来。如果你热爱教育,拥抱变化,渴望成长,我们诚挚邀请你加入我们的创新团队,一起书写教育的新篇章。

立即行动:访问我们的招聘页面,提交你的申请,开启一段激动人心的职业旅程!